What you will be doing:
- Guidance and Compliance: Provide expert guidance to management on employee relations matters including disciplinary, performance, grievance and flexible working, ensuring compliance with employment law and company policies.
- Investigation: Conduct thorough investigations into intricate, HR‑related employee grievances and ethics cases, resolving conflicts and recommending appropriate actions.
- Consultation: Manage consultation actions such as TUPE and redundancy consultation (both collective and individual).
- Terminations: Handle sensitive, in‑depth, involuntary terminations.
- Training: Deliver training programs for managers on employee relations topics, such as conflict resolution and effective communication. Policy coaching for managers on performance management, disciplinary and flexible working process.
